Bored Out Of My Mind

by Joan Serratelli

Sitting here,
writing a poem
Could care less
what's on the tube

Later, you'll tell me
that ALL I ever do
is watch TV

I HATE TV
I would shut it off
IF I could find
the remote

It's crappy outside
I'm in a cold sweat
I would smoke a cigarette
(if someone would teach
me how)

I feel so alone
I have no money
and no place
to go
So here I sit;
ALONE

...BORED
Out Of My Mind
